In today’s fast-paced, tech-driven world, landing a job is more challenging than ever for new graduates. Having a degree is no longer enough; employers want a well-rounded candidate with technical skills, communication prowess, adaptability, problem-solving abilities, and digital literacy, all backed by real-world experience.
